LEAVE IT THE WAY YOU FOUND IT

If you “pack it in, pack it out. Leave it the way you found it,” says J.P. Wood, waste management officer for the Municipality of Colchester, of anyone visiting the area’s waterfalls or other natural/wilderness sites.

We’re noticing litter is still very much an issue. If you find a bank that leads to a waterway, you are going to find garbage. I don’t know why,” he says. “It’s definitely a head-scratcher.” And, if more people were conscientious about taking their garbage back with them when hiking, swimming, or partaking in whatever outdoor activities, people such as Jeremy Smith would not have to feel the need to pick up other people’s trash. Nonetheless – “It’s nice to see somebody like Jeremy taking it upon themselves.” Wood said anyone who sees signs of illegal dumping or any degree of waste being left somewhere is asked to call the municipal Helpline at 902 895-4777.
